Simoladagene autotemcel (OTL-101) is an autologous ex vivo hematopoietic stem cell (HSC) gene therapy developed for the treatment of adenosine deaminase deficiency-severe combined immunodeficiency (ADA-SCID), a rare and life-threatening genetic disorder. The therapy involves the extraction of a patient's own CD34+ hematopoietic stem and progenitor cells, which are then genetically modified ex vivo using a self-inactivating lentiviral vector to insert a functional copy of the human adenosine deaminase (ADA) gene. Following non-myeloablative busulfan conditioning, the modified cells are re-infused into the patient. Once engrafted in the bone marrow, these cells proliferate and differentiate into various immune cell lineages, providing a continuous source of the ADA enzyme. This restoration of enzyme activity prevents the accumulation of toxic metabolites such as deoxyadenosine triphosphate (dATP), thereby allowing for the development and maintenance of a functional immune system and protecting against life-threatening infections.
